On Sat, Mar 11, 2006 at 02:20:55PM -0500, Matthias Julius wrote:
> Forget about ide-scsi! cdrecord doesn't need it anymore. It can use
> ATA drives directly.
But it's not an ATA drive, it's a USB drive. Both the DVD-RW and CD-RW
even point to the same device:
$ ls -l /dev/*rw
lrwxrwxrwx 1 root root 4 2006-03-09 11:04 /dev/cdrw -> scd0
lrwxrwxrwx 1 root root 4 2006-03-09 11:04 /dev/dvdrw -> scd0
so it doesn't explain why one works and the other doesn't, except that
burning DVDs doesn't use cdrecord. That's why I assume the problem lies
there.
